EL-RUFAI VISITED GBAGYI VILLA AND VOWED TO DEMOLISH GBAGYI VILLA DESPITE THAT THE MATTER IS BEFORE A COURT OF COMPETENT JURISDICTION: ARISE NEWS CAPTURES EL-RUFAI’S STATEMENT AND DETAILS OF THE VISIT:

The people of Gbagyi Villa suddenly woke up on Thursday, 21st July 2016 to hear the news that Governor Nasir El-Rufai was coming on a visit by 1.00pm the same day. According to a source in Gbagyi Villa, “No body knows the purpose of his sudden visit.” From about 9.46am heavy security had been mounted all over Gbagyi Villa, but El-Rufai never came till about 3.05pm. He came in through unusual entrance where he briefly stopped to address journalists.

Despite coming with about 5 different black jeeps and other vehicles in his heavy convoy, he was in a tinted-glass coaster bus that no one would ever suspect he would have boarded. He spent about 1 hours going round the Kaduna Polytechnic edge of Gbagyi Villa in company of members of Kaduna Polytechnic management, top government functionaries and top officers of KASUPDA
The governor, who didn’t address the people of the community, neither was he having any representative of the community in his entourage however, addressed journalists after the tour that lasted till about 4.07pm.

EL-RUFAI’S ADDRESS
In his address to the journalist he said, the residents of Gbagyi Villa’s encroachment on the land belonging to KADPOLY is a tragedy in many ways, because on the one hand Kaduna Polytechnic got allocated the place nearly 40 years ago for the purpose of establishing initially a school of mining and subsequently a college of environmental studies, which would have brought great benefit not only to the Gbagyi community, but also Kaduna State and country as well.

Unfortunately, as we stand today, according to KADPOLY Rector and I believe him, nearly 70% of the Land has been encroached by illegal squatters. These buildings will have to go. The state government went through a process, gave everyone opportunity to show that he or she has a title to the land and approval to build, If you don’t have these two, the law will apply and we would take the buildings down.

He maintained that, “It is unfortunate that some people have been deceived to think that this land is available for sale, and we are going to investigate and find out all those involved in this deception and they would be dealt with by the government. The law will prevail and ignorance of law is no defense.”

MANY TO LOSE THOUSANDS AND MILLIONS OF NAIRA OF THEIR SAVINGS
“It is quite unfortunate to see that many people will lose thousands and millions of naira of their savings for building illegally. Before you build anything, make sure you have Certificate of Occupancy for the land or building and get approval, if you don’t have it, your building is at risk. I don’t know any other thing than to uphold my oath of office and to ensure that the law is obeyed. We did not conduct illegality in this case and in Kaduna State, you cannot hide behind your religious or ethnic group to break the law and get away with it.” He asserted.

DESPITE THE CASE IN COURT
When asked about the on-going case in court over the Gbagyi Villa planned demolition issue he responded, ”The case in court has little to do with breaking the law, if you break the law you can’t go to court. This is a criminal act and the case in court is a civil matter. You cannot steal and go to court to stop prosecution. These are two separate matters; the law must be applied for all of us to be saved.”

NO COMPENSATION FOR GBAGYI VILLA RESIDENTS AS CRIMINALS
On whether the people will be compensated, he declared that the people are criminals, asking if criminals should be compensated for their crime. He however, lamented that “there are about 1,500 houses with only about 500 completed and the people will lose thousands and millions of naira of their savings for building illegally.” He concluded.
